Historicalty, WICF arose out of 0￿r 20 yeaTS of retreats run by John Crook at Maenllwyd. hLs
farmhouse In Mld-Wales.11 was f0ftT￿, at hi5 prompts'ng, In 1997 and registered as a charity in 1998
with John Crook 85 Its flrst formal TeaGher. Thereafter 14VCF took ov8r the running of such retreats
and In Ils latter years also wtdened its remit by running them at other venues throughout the UK.
Slmon Chlkl was appolnted a5 the GuNJinll Teacher of WCF In 2011 after the sudden death of John
Crook. John Crook and Simon Chihj were ￿th Dharma Helrs of Chan Master Sheng Yen. Slmon
trained for OV8T 30 years with both John Crook aThJ Master Sheng Yen, and was the Secretary of the
WCF from tts founding until 2011.
ObJectlvo8 and actlvltlo•
ObJ•cts and •lms
Our purpo$e5 are sel out In the objects whhln our Constitution, and are:
1. to advance the educatlon of the publlc In o&neral on th8 8ubJed of the prtndples and pracilce of
Buddhlsm; and
2. to adv8nc8 th8 relblon of B￿ldh1$M prfndpally but not excluslvely In the Unltad Klngdom for the
benefft of the publlc.,
in each ca58 by provkjlng tralnlng In the Llnll aThJ Caodono trndrtk)ns of Chan Buddhlsm, a5
Iransmrtted through Master Sheng Yen, and dlstrlbuting maleri815 about 8uddhlsm In wrftten and other
medla lo Info￿ others 8bout BuddhL8m, and, as a supplement to such advoncement, to explore the
re18tlonshlp between Chan pra¢tl¢e. Chan Iheory and other meditallve practSce$ and understandlng.
In pursult of these purposes. we alm lo provhje a year-round programme of resldentlal med6tatlon
retreats of v8Wng lenglh led by our teachers who are all based fimly In Ihe Chan Tradrt￿n. The
medtt8Jon and InstThJ¢tion are dr￿n from the Chan Buddhlsl tradition. 14Ve fj￿ not sectsrian, but
prlmarlly draw upon teachings th8t gre compatlble wlth the Chan tradition and ils focus on meditation
a5 8 beneflcl81 Iransfomwllve proces5, With our ￿treats concenlratlng on sllenl rnedltalion rather than
rltuat-based or Imurglcal content. We alm to make retreats and off-stte 8dlviiies 8ccesslble to all and
to pro￿de financ1818ss15tsnce wlth the cosl of retreats for pèople on low Incornes.

As is common In the Buddhlst tradition our teachers offer their servlces free of ¢h8rge. Retreatants
are invited to make donatlons, known In the Buddhlst tradltlon as 'dana', to help the teachers wlth Ihelr
liwng oosts and enable them to continue gi￿n9 Ih8lr time to le8chlng. Thls helps us keep our wlces
low whllst stlll belng able to offer retreats led ty experlenced lesthe￿.

WCF Groups
The chaiity supports 14 loe41 groups throuohout Great Britain. To ensure that th8 charity c￿ntinUeS to
abkde by ts obj'ects and stay true to the Chan lineage, eath Is18d by an approved 188der. Each group
Leader has a pe￿Onal mentor drawn from our retreat leaders. To develop and support thi5 85ped of
the charity, a Leaders, Retreat is run annually which comblnes tralnlng wlth support and Sangha
{community> develowent. In order to ensure future leaders bolh for groups and the charity, potential
group leade￿ are a150 in¥tted to such retreats to start th8 proc£ss of under5tandlng the possibililies
within th8 charity for both their pernonal development ond Ihe rol8s on offer for COM￿thed ¥dunteers.
A Leade￿, Retreat was hell In 2023.
